開源和雲成了資料庫的增長引擎?
“一個好的資料庫產品不是研發出來的,而是用出來的。”是基礎軟體從業者的共識,能否很好理解並實踐這個共識很大程度上決定了一家資料庫創業公司能走多遠。
在眾多中國資料庫廠商中,PingCAP是一個明星獨角獸,旗下資料庫品牌TiDB常年霸榜墨天輪中國資料庫流行排行榜,並且進入了DB-Engines關係型資料庫流行度排行的Top50,這足以說明其在海外也有不錯的影響力。
PingCAP是靠什麼短短几年成長為獨角獸的?PingCAP聯合創始人&CTO黃東旭總結為找到PMF,並擁有兩大增長引擎——開源和雲。
找到自己的PMF
“如果大家跟我一起穿越回七年前,很多朋友問我,你們當時最頭疼的問題是什麼?”在日前舉辦的“TiDB V6 暨 PingCAP 雲戰略釋出會”上,黃東旭回顧過去說道,“親身感受告訴我做一個資料庫並不是特別難的事情,去測試一個資料庫,證明他是能夠用的,做對反而比做出這個資料庫更難。”
最近3個月黃東旭在矽谷拜訪了大量創業公司,他發現很多創業公司在開始創業時思考的並不是專案或產品的技術含量多高,多厲害或者多難,而是要找到產品市場契合點PMF(Product Market Fit)。
2017年TiDB 1.0GA,高度相容MySQL並解決其擴充套件性瓶頸是該公司找到的第一個PMF。隨著資料海量爆發,MySQL、PG等傳統資料庫架構在擴充套件性方面出現了瓶頸。TiDB是基於谷歌Spanner論文實現的分散式關係型資料庫,存算分離的架構提供了靈活的彈性擴充套件能力。
來自 slintel
MySQL是當下全球最受歡迎的關係型資料庫,根據slintel.com的最新資料,在全球關係型資料庫市場,MySQL市場份額遙居第一,佔了關係型資料庫近半壁江山(43.56%)。隨著海量資料爆發增長的新需求或為高度相容MySQL的TiDB提供了可想象的空間。
PingCAP 找到的另一個PMF是支援HTAP場景,TiDB 在 4.0 版本中引入列儲存引擎 TiFlash 結合行儲存引擎 TiKV 構建 HTAP 資料庫,在增加少量儲存成本的情況下,可以在同一個系統中做聯機交易處理、實時資料分析,能夠節省企業成本。黃東旭認為,對客戶最重要的可能不是技術、穩定性、擴充套件性和效能等技術性指標,而是找到對應的場景能提供商業價值,TiDB的HTAP能力對應了實時敏捷資料需求的場景。
PingCAP副總裁劉松介紹,HTAP有廣泛的應用場景,金融機構中性對實時性的業務,尤其是從交易到分析需要快速形成閉環的業務場景,如風控、實時促銷等,金融機構已經開始把HTAP當作剛需。此外,對實時資料非常敏感的領域對HTAP能力也有需求,如新一代Web3.0、NFT、區塊鏈這類技術,希望用實時資料推動業務發展。也有分析機構如Gartner指出,新第一代資料庫如果沒有HTAP能力,就沒有進入到新一代資料庫市場的籌碼,如今,HTAP變成了資料庫能力的一個必選項。
的確,今年以來,谷歌雲釋出AlloyDB、Snowflake釋出行儲存引擎UniStore,紛紛進軍HTAP,HTAP亦成為資料庫領域的一大熱點。黃東旭認為雖然都是HTAP,但是各有各的應用場景和目標客戶群,且目前相關產品都還比較新,判斷未來的發展依然言之過早。
讓使用者聲音更快進入產品
資料庫是應用的底層支撐,企業在選型資料庫產品的時候會格外慎重,不太敢用沒有經過大規模實際場景驗證的產品,一款通用的資料庫產品需要在廣泛真實場景中真刀真槍磨練,傾聽使用者端聲音,才能不斷成長,變得可用,甚至好用。
黃東旭認為包括資料庫在內的新產品在早期要解決三個問題,一是獲得客戶信任,二是有更多曝光,讓更多人知道,三是產品穩定成熟。而加速迭代能解決以上三個問題,“其實(加速迭代)核心的理念,關鍵在於使用者的聲音有多快能夠進入產品內部。”
TiDB在一開始即選擇開源策略發展,利用開源的分散式協作,利用群策群力的社群力量加速使用者觸達與產品迭代。黃東旭認為開源是TiDB第一個增長引擎,他曾經多次強調,現在做基礎軟體只有選擇開源才能成功。
一個開源社群需要由開發者、貢獻者、佈道者、使用者幾個角色構成,理想狀態下,如果社群足夠活躍,更多的使用者使用,更多的產品問題會在生產環境中暴露出來,其中絕大多數問題可以在社群內部解決,解決問題和修復bug後可以反哺到產品本身,使產品更成熟強大,進而促使更多人使用,實現正向迴圈的自增長,幾個角色之間形成飛輪效應,不斷壯大。據悉,目前TiDB開源版本使用者70%的問題可以在社群內部解決。
雲時代,雲也成為實現使用者觸達的一個重要途徑,雲被視作TiDB的第二個增長引擎。
從去年開始,TiDB在雲端動作頻繁,2021年9月,TiDB 上線亞馬遜雲科技 Marketplace(中國區),2022年1月,PingCAP 全託管的資料庫即服務(DBaaS)產品 TiDB Cloud 正式登陸亞馬遜雲科技 Marketplace,5 月 11 日,TiDB Cloud 在全球範圍正式商用。上個月,TiDB Cloud上線了 Google Cloud Marketplace,並與阿里雲合作,結合雙方技術優勢打造的雲資料庫 TiDB 正式上線阿里雲心選商城。
PingCAP 首席技術佈道師馬曉宇介紹,雲降低了使用門檻,可以實現更廣泛的使用者觸達,也會為產品帶來更快的迭代速度。透過觀察他發現,針對TiDB使用情況,雲縮短了反饋鏈路,比社群反饋節奏可能還要快,根據雲端反饋對資料庫產品做相應強化和最佳化,“雲會對整個核心的促進有一個非常大的助力,這些助力最終也會回饋到社群使用者或那些不用雲的使用者。”
根據去年年底資料,TiDB開源版本在國內接近40%用在公有云上。近期IDC釋出的《2021年下半年中國關係型資料庫軟體市場跟蹤報告》顯示,2021年下半年中國公有云關係型資料庫規模增速明顯。整體來看,2021下半年中國關係型資料庫軟體市場規模為15.8億美元,同比增長34.9%。其中,公有云關係型資料庫規模8.7億美元,同比增長48.7%;本地部署關係型資料庫規模7.1億美元,同比增長21.1%。
一直以來TiDB將自己定位為全球化的中國資料庫公司,相比於中國市場,海外使用者對公有云的需求更強烈。透過開源與雲兩大增長引擎,TiDB已經收穫了不少海外使用者。劉松介紹,多雲平臺的支援是資料庫發展趨勢,越來越多的客戶至少部署在兩朵雲上。
開源與雲成為了TiDB的兩大增長引擎,未來PingCAP也會在兩個方向不斷投入。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/69925873/viewspace-2904801/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- NoSQL最新現狀和趨勢:雲NoSQL資料庫將成重要增長引擎SQL資料庫
- 雲開發資料庫又增新技能!資料庫
- 統計資料庫每天的資料增長量資料庫
- 如何估算Oracle資料庫每日資料增長量Oracle資料庫
- 開源搜尋引擎相關資料
- 坑!火山引擎雲資料庫 MySQL 版節點記憶體只增不減資料庫MySql記憶體
- MySQL 資料庫 InnoDB 和 MyISAM 資料引擎的差別MySql資料庫
- 8個祕訣成就頂級增長黑客 | 如何運用資料試驗打造增長引擎黑客
- 如何監控ORACLE資料庫表的增長量Oracle資料庫
- 開源資料庫的現狀資料庫
- MySQL之父造訪騰訊雲 為騰訊雲資料庫開源點贊MySql資料庫
- 開源分散式圖資料庫的思考和實踐分散式資料庫
- 您能否應對您的資料庫增長挑戰?資料庫
- 完全無事務的資料庫SCN增長之謎資料庫
- 【MySQL】自定義資料庫連線池和開源資料庫連線池的使用MySql資料庫
- 開源的誘惑——資料庫篇資料庫
- ChatGPT “眼”中的開源資料庫ChatGPT資料庫
- 雲伺服器innodb資料庫轉引擎為MyISAM伺服器資料庫
- .NET 開源快捷的資料庫文件查詢和生成工具資料庫
- 資料庫系列:MySQL引擎MyISAM和InnoDB的比較資料庫MySql
- 40個最佳免費和開源NoSQL資料庫SQL資料庫
- 開源資料庫流行度首次超過非開源資料庫Confluent資料庫
- [提問交流]OT的資料庫引擎可以換成InnoDB資料庫引擎嗎?資料庫
- 移動廣告和優惠劵的增長–資料資訊圖
- 【融雲分析】從過剩儲存資源到分散式時序資料庫的長儲存分散式資料庫
- 華為雲開源時序資料庫openGemini:使用列存引擎解決時序高基數問題資料庫
- 一個通過rms寫成的小型資料庫引擎,簡單的資料庫引擎資料庫
- PouchDB:一個開源的 JS 資料庫JS資料庫
- Gartner對開源資料庫的研究(轉)資料庫
- 華雲資料加入龍蜥社群,推動開源產業快速有序成長產業
- 安卓開發向資料庫新增中文變成了?怎麼解決安卓資料庫
- 試用開源資料庫ApacheDerby資料庫Apache
- 研究表明開源領域已不再增長
- 分散式資料庫火了 開源填補資料庫空白分散式資料庫
- 天雲大資料獲1億增資,釋出HTAP資料庫Hubble大資料資料庫
- 資料庫的簡介和MySQL增刪改查資料庫MySql
- aardio封裝庫) 微軟開源的js引擎(ChakraCore)封裝微軟JS
- Oracle資料庫日常問題-歸檔異常增長Oracle資料庫